Council considers NOPEC ‘no-knock’ registry to curb door-to-door utility and solicitor sales
Summary
Councilmembers discussed a proposed ordinance to join a NOPEC-managed no-solicitation registry that would prevent registered addresses from being approached by door-to-door vendors and energy solicitors; the mayor said the ordinance will be administered by the Code Office and NOPEC materials have already been reviewed
The Planning and Development Committee reviewed a proposed "no-knock" or no-solicitation program administered through NOPEC to limit door-to-door vendor and utility solicitations in Athens.
